Flash Fiction: This month I am sharing Evacuate by Valerie O'Riordan. Be warned before you read that it's a visceral and violent piece. I've always been interested in 'end of the world' narratives, mostly from my love of zombie movies to be honest. What I like about this take on the theme is the huge sense of character that O'Riordan develops, culminating in that stinging final line - "I look at Ma who's wailing and I shout happy now?" It feels pretty realistic within such a genre story to have an unhappy child shout this and I like the mesh and clash of the very serious subject matter, with the tone and voice in this flash. 

 

Short Story: This month I am sharing the classic chiller Where Are You Going, Where Have You Been? By Joyce Carol Oates, which honestly I could talk about for hours, so I'll keep it short here. It's fair to say that my favourite genre of ... well, anything really, could be classed as 'well, this is a nice normal day, oh no it absolutely is NOT' and here we have a shining example. There is some true life background to the story which deepens it for me, there's the symbols on the car, there's the question of whether Arnold is human or not ... and of course, the ultimate question? Why does she agree to go with him at the end?
